解决Claude Code访问不稳定问题并实现无缝对接Taotoken
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度
解决Claude Code访问不稳定问题并实现无缝对接Taotoken
许多开发者将Claude Code作为日常编程辅助工具,但在使用过程中,有时会遇到访问限制或Token资源不足的情况,影响开发效率。通过将Claude Code的请求配置转发至Taotoken平台,可以利用其聚合分发能力,获得更稳定的访问体验和更灵活的Token资源管理。本文将介绍具体的配置方法。
1. 理解Claude Code与Taotoken的对接原理
Claude Code作为一款编程助手工具,其核心功能依赖于后端的大语言模型API。默认情况下,它通常直接连接至特定的模型服务提供商。当开发者遇到访问不稳定或资源配额问题时,一个有效的解决方案是修改其连接的后端端点。
Taotoken平台提供了与Anthropic模型协议兼容的API通道。这意味着,支持自定义Anthropic API Base URL的工具,如Claude Code,可以通过简单的配置变更,将其请求指向Taotoken。此后,所有的模型调用将通过Taotoken平台进行路由和分发,由平台处理后续的供应商连接、计费和稳定性保障。
这种配置变更不涉及修改Claude Code的客户端代码,仅需调整其连接设置,是一种非侵入式的解决方案。
2. 获取必要的配置信息
在开始配置之前,您需要在Taotoken平台准备两项关键信息:API Key和模型ID。
首先,访问Taotoken控制台,创建一个API Key。这个Key将作为Claude Code向Taotoken发起请求时的身份凭证。建议为Claude Code单独创建一个Key,便于后续的用量追踪和管理。
其次,在平台的模型广场中,找到您希望Claude Code使用的模型。Taotoken平台提供了多种模型选项,您需要记录下目标模型对应的唯一模型ID。这个ID将在配置过程中指定Claude Code使用哪个具体的模型服务。
请妥善保管您的API Key,避免泄露。
3. 配置Claude Code连接至Taotoken
Claude Code的配置主要通过修改其配置文件完成。根据您使用的操作系统,配置文件的位置有所不同。
在macOS或Linux系统上,配置文件通常位于用户主目录下的.claude文件夹中,具体路径为~/.claude/settings.json。在Windows系统上,路径则为%USERPROFILE%\.claude\settings.json。
您可以使用文本编辑器打开这个JSON格式的配置文件。在其中,您需要找到或添加与API连接相关的配置项。关键配置项如下:
ANTHROPIC_BASE_URL: 此配置项用于指定API的基础地址。您需要将其值设置为Taotoken的Anthropic兼容通道地址:https://taotoken.net/api。请注意,此地址末尾不包含/v1路径,这与标准的OpenAI兼容接口不同。ANTHROPIC_AUTH_TOKEN: 此配置项用于设置API密钥。请将您在Taotoken控制台创建的API Key填写在此处。ANTHROPIC_MODEL: 此配置项用于指定默认使用的模型。请填入您在Taotoken模型广场中选定的模型ID。
一个配置示例如下:
{ "env": { "ANTHROPIC_BASE_URL": "https://taotoken.net/api", "ANTHROPIC_AUTH_TOKEN": "sk-您的实际Taotoken API Key", "ANTHROPIC_MODEL": "claude-3-5-sonnet-20241022" } }修改并保存配置文件后,重启Claude Code客户端,新的配置即可生效。
4. 使用Taotoken CLI工具快速配置
除了手动编辑配置文件,您也可以使用Taotoken官方提供的CLI工具来简化配置流程。该工具通过交互式菜单引导您完成设置。
首先,您需要安装CLI工具。可以通过npm包管理器进行安装:
npm install -g @taotoken/taotoken或者,为了不进行全局安装,您也可以使用npx直接运行:
npx @taotoken/taotoken安装完成后,在终端中运行taotoken命令。工具会启动一个交互式菜单,选择与Claude Code相关的配置选项。随后,按照提示依次输入您的Taotoken API Key和想要使用的模型ID。CLI工具会自动帮您生成或更新本地的Claude Code配置文件。
这种方法避免了手动查找配置文件和编辑JSON的步骤,尤其适合不熟悉命令行编辑的用户。
5. 验证配置与后续管理
配置完成后,建议进行一次简单的测试来验证连接是否成功。您可以在Claude Code中尝试提出一个简单的编程问题,观察其是否能够正常返回响应。如果遇到错误,请检查上述配置项的值是否正确,特别是Base URL的格式和API Key的有效性。
连接至Taotoken后,您所有的Claude Code使用量都会通过该API Key在Taotoken平台进行统计。您可以随时登录Taotoken控制台,在用量看板中查看详细的Token消耗情况、调用次数和费用信息。这为个人或团队管理AI辅助编程的成本提供了清晰的视图。
通过将Claude Code对接至Taotoken,开发者可以将模型访问的稳定性交由平台处理,同时获得一个统一的入口来管理多个AI工具的调用资源,简化了运维和成本治理的复杂度。
开始体验更稳定的编程助手服务,您可以访问 Taotoken 创建API Key并查看支持的模型。
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度
